What Is A Air Relief Valve. air valves allow excess air to escape from the pipeline while containing pipeline fluids within the pipeline during operation. The working principle of the air compressor pressure relief valve is very simple. The valves can inject air into the pipes while they are being emptied, preventing a vacuum, which would cause the pipe to collapse. air relief valves are designed to release air pockets that can cause water surge, potentially leading to pipe damage. These valves are crucial for the efficient operation and protection of the system. In contrast, air release valves are adept at expelling air from the system, effectively mitigating water surge events and safeguarding the infrastructure from potential damage. an air release valve is typically used in water or irrigation schemes to ensure that any entrained air in the water system is automatically released in order to maximize the system performance. an air release valve (arv), also known as an air relief valve, plays a critical role in ensuring the smooth operation and efficiency of various. Whether it be a water distribution line or sewage main, you can be sure to find an air valve. They also allow air to escape from the pipes during filling. a pressure relief valve characterized by rapid opening or closing or by gradual opening or closing, generally proportional to the. air relief valves, also known as air release valves, are used in piping systems to automatically release trapped air or gas. air valves are an essential part of water supply networks. Entrained air pockets in pipes can cause excessive head loss and flow reductions if air is not effectively released.
